On average 88.9 submissions per 1,000 patients in August 2025

The range = 0 to 884.8 online consults, per day, per practice

Why do @NHSEngland @DHSCgovuk insist on treating all practices the same?

Why can’t we temporarily pause online when we are full?

This is not safe

According to this data

💥5,967 (over 96%) of practices in England have at least one online consultation system
 
💥5.1 million patient online submissions occurred in August

💥3.5 million clinical, the rest admin

(For context every A&E nationwide offers 67,000/day)

If @wesstreeting thinks GPs are stuck in 20thC, visit a hospital

We are the science museum!

➡️Electronic records since 1991
➡️Online triage
➡️Ambient scribes
➡️SMS
➡️Online bookings
➡️Electronic prescribing
➡️Online referrals
➡️Video consults DAYS after 1st lockdown….

GPCE clear what’s needed to ⬇️doubt ⬆️confidence & avoid disputes:

1. Roadmap & timelines for GMS contract renewal & transparency of investment

2. ARRS > practice-level reimbursement

3. Additional practice-level scheme to reduce GP
under/unemployment asap….
